Dr. Heavenly Kimes and Dr. Contessa Metcalfe’s friendship has come to an end.
‘Married To Medicine’s’ Quad Webb announced that Dr. Heavenly Kimes and Dr. Contessa Metcalfe have called it quits on their friendship due to a botched “intervention” that took place on the reality show.
In a recent interview, Quad Webb said:
“Those two will never see eye to eye.”
Quad Webb continued:
“I don’t think the trust is there anymore. I don’t think that they even desire to want to rebuild or restore a friendship.”

Quad Webb
On Sunday’s (July 31) episode of the Bravo reality show, Dr. Contessa Metcalfe, occupational medicine doctor, invited Dr. Heavenly Kimes to her home to enjoy a girls’ night with the rest of the cast members. However, after Dr. Heavenly Kimes, 51, entered Dr. Contessa Metcalfe’s basement theater she was subjected to an “intervention” where she had to watch a montage of herself throwing verbal attacks at her co-stars.
While speaking on the situation, Quad admitted:
“Heavenly … said a lot of nasty things about every one of us and is that something that a friend should do or a person who says they’re a friend? No, absolutely not.”
Quad acknowledged that the explosive fight that followed between Heavenly and the women could’ve been prevented if Heavenly, a medical dentist, had a heads-up about the intervention prior to her arrival.

Heavenly Kimes
She said:
“When we’re talking about an intervention, we’re trying to get to the core of a reason. I don’t feel that Contessa going to get her enemies to say this was an ‘intervention’ was the right thing to do.”
During her interview, Quad, who divorced Dr. Gregory Lunceford in 2018 after eight years of marriage, also spoke on Heavenly claiming she sleeps with married men. She said:
“I was very disappointed to hear that from her because she knows better than that.”
Quad elaborated:
“I don’t even dance in front of the other women’s husbands because I know that … I am very beautiful and very pretty and I know that I can be desirable amongst many. But I am respectful.”
Quad admitted that it will take more than what transpired to move past the issue. She said:
“I thought that was a load of bulls—t when she said that and I still don’t like it and I’m going to deal with that accordingly. So Heavenly has to hear that from me, for sure.”
